Caltechsys Salary

As of April 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Caltechsys in the United States is $89,204.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$43. Salaries at Caltechsys typically range from $77,863 to $102,197 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Caltechsys
Caltechsys provides entire computer support from PC to Internet Servers. Our in-house technicians service all major hardware manufacturers. On-site support is the Greater Houston area. We relieve the customer of needless hours of research and warranty issues, freeing up network staff. We provide liaison between manufacturers and clients. What Is the Cost of Living Near Houston?

Understanding the cost of living near Houston is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Caltechsys.
Houston's Cost of Living Index is approximately 98.5 (1.5% less expensive than US average; 5.9% more than TX average). Major city, energy/medical hub, housing generally affordable for size, but varies. METRO bus/rail. When planning your budget based on a salary from Caltechsys,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,200 - $1,800+ A significant portion of Caltechsys sal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 (High AC use)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(METRO Q Card monthly)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$590 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,570 - $4,090+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
